‍World Cup Final 2023 : Australia Clinches Victory Against India

The highly anticipated ICC Men’s Cricket World Cup final between India and Australia came to a thrilling conclusion in Ahmedabad, India on November 19, 2023. Australia emerged victorious, securing their sixth World Cup title and putting an end to India’s dominant run in their home tournament. The match, witnessed by a massive crowd at the Narendra Modi Stadium, showcased exceptional performances from both teams, with Travis Head’s magnificent century playing a pivotal role in Australia’s triumph.

India’s Dominance and Australia’s Resurgence

India’s journey to the final had been impressive, winning all ten of their previous matches in the tournament. The team, backed by a passionate fanbase of 1.4 billion people, was seeking their third World Cup title. However, Australia proved to be a formidable opponent, outplaying India in every department of the game.

Winning the toss, Australia chose to field first, putting India in to bat. However, India struggled to find their momentum on a slow pitch and were restricted to a total of 240 all out. The only significant contributions came from Virat Kohli, who scored a half-century, and Lokesh Rahul, who also reached the 50-run mark.

Head’s Heroics and Labuschagne’s Support

Australia’s chase got off to a shaky start, losing three early wickets and leaving them at 47-3 after seven overs. However, Travis Head, displaying incredible resilience and skill, took charge of the innings. He formed a crucial partnership with Marnus Labuschagne, and together they steadied the ship for Australia.

Head’s innings was nothing short of extraordinary. He became only the fifth player in history to score a century in a men’s World Cup final, joining the ranks of Ricky Ponting and Adam Gilchrist. His 137-run knock played a pivotal role in Australia’s victory, providing the foundation for their successful chase.

A Record-Breaking Partnership

The partnership between Head and Labuschagne was a defining moment in the match. They combined for a remarkable 192-run partnership, effectively taking the game away from India. Labuschagne’s unbeaten 58 provided the perfect support to Head’s aggressive strokeplay, ensuring Australia’s path to victory.

The Moment of Triumph

With just one ball remaining in the match, Head was dismissed, caught in the deep while attempting to hit a title-clinching boundary. However, Glenn Maxwell, who replaced Head at the crease, calmly secured the winning runs with a two off his first ball. The victory sparked celebrations among the Australian team and their supporters, with fireworks lighting up the sky above the Narendra Modi Stadium.

Australia’s World Cup Legacy

Australia’s triumph in the 2023 Cricket World Cup marks their sixth title in the history of the tournament. Their dominance in one-day international cricket is evident, with previous victories in 1987, 1999, 2003, 2007, and 2015. This record-breaking win solidifies Australia’s status as one of the most successful teams in World Cup history.
